Earthquake Insights Seminar: Unveiling Discoveries and Preparedness Strategies – Lessons learned from the M7.8 Türkiye Earthquake of 6 February 2023
Date: Friday, October 13, 2023, Time: 1:00 to 5:00 p.m. PDT
Location: UBC Robson Square or Online
Registration Link: https://engineering.ubc.ca/earthquake-insights-registration
Abstract
For an informative event, professors from the University of British Columbia’s Civil Engineering Department, along with faculty from other leading universities, will share their findings from a recent research expedition to Türkiye.
This event serves as a unique platform to not only unravel the complexities of earthquakes but also to advocate for enhanced earthquake preparedness and safety measures in Canada.
